The Toyota repair market in and around Barboursville, WV is characterized by a small number of highly specialized, independent shops rather than a high volume of general mechanics or dealerships. The highest concentration of expertise is found in neighboring Huntington, which acts as the regional service center. Competition among the top specialists is strong, driving a high standard of quality and customer service. These top-tier shops are consistently booked in advance, indicating strong local trust. Pricing is generally competitive and often more affordable than dealership rates, with labor rates typically ranging from $95 to $125 per hour. For highly specific TRD performance upgrades or complex hybrid battery issues, residents may still need to travel to a dedicated Toyota dealership in a larger metropolitan area like Charleston.

Common questions about toyota repair services in Barboursville, WV
Due to our hilly terrain and winter road treatments, common local repairs include brake system servicing, suspension component replacement (like struts and control arms), and addressing undercarriage rust. For Toyotas, this often means specific attention to components like brake calipers and CV joints on popular models like the RAV4 and Camry.
Look for shops that are ASE-certified and have technicians with specific Toyota training. In the local area, check for long-standing businesses with strong community reputations and look for evidence of specialized diagnostic tools for Toyota systems, which are crucial for accurate repairs on modern models.
Typically, dealership labor rates are higher, but they use OEM parts and have manufacturer-specific expertise. For complex computer or hybrid system issues, the dealership might be more efficient. For general maintenance and common repairs, a qualified independent shop in the Barboursville area can offer significant savings, especially on labor.
Seek immediate service if you notice symptoms like poor braking on our steep hills, signs of overheating (especially in summer traffic on I-64), or if the check engine light is flashing. Ignoring these can lead to more severe damage and costly repairs, particularly given the stress of local driving conditions.
The winter salt and seasonal potholes necessitate more frequent undercarriage inspections and tire/wheel alignments. It's also wise to have your battery tested before winter, as cold snaps can weaken older batteries. Using a local shop familiar with these regional wear patterns can help you proactively address issues.
